Wood County's 2025 annual median AQI is 39 (Good), with 85.3% Good days
According to the U.S. EPA Air Quality System, Wood County, Ohio posted a 2025 median AQI of 39 (Good) across 244 monitored days, with 85.3% rated Good and 0 unhealthy or worse. This is an annual comparison, not today's advisory.

How did Wood County's air break down in 2025?
Across 244 monitored days, 208 fell in the Good band (AQI 0–50) and 0 reached Unhealthy or worse. The worst single day peaked at AQI 108 (USG).

2024 daily-monitor rhythm in Wood County
Month-by-month median AQI from EPA day-level county monitors (245 reported days in 2024). May posted the highest typical readings (median AQI 47, peak 87); Mar was cleanest at median 34.
Five-year seasonal record
EPA day-level county files · 2020–20241,202 daily readings show a recurring local pattern: Jun has the highest matched-month median AQI (48), while Oct is lowest (30). Each cell is that month’s median daily AQI, not a current-air forecast.

5-Year Air Quality Trend
Air quality is worsening in Wood County. Highest Good-day share: 2020 (94.3%, 216 of 229 monitored days).
| Year | Good | Moderate | USG | Unhealthy | Median AQI | Max AQI |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2020 | 216 | 13 | 0 | 0 | 34 | 80 |
| 2021 | 216 | 29 | 0 | 0 | 39 | 90 |
| 2022 | 220 | 22 | 0 | 0 | 38 | 97 |
| 2023 | 198 | 39 | 4 | 0 | 40 | 126 |
| 2024 | 203 | 41 | 1 | 0 | 41 | 101 |
| 2025 | 208 | 35 | 1 | 0 | 39 | 108 |
